The article explores how ants exhibit remarkable traffic efficiency by avoiding overtaking and utilizing pheromone-based communication. This natural behavior, according to researcher Guerrieri, could inspire innovative traffic systems, particularly for connected and autonomous vehicles (CAVs). By mimicking the ants’ smart communication methods, urban transport systems could achieve greater efficiency and reduce congestion.
